Trick Daddy, the artist behind this quote, is known for his distinctive style in hip-hop music and his candid discussions about personal struggles. Born as Terry Gillem in Miami, Florida, Trick Daddy has been a prominent figure in the South Florida rap scene since the late 1990s. His music often reflects on themes of survival, hardship, and overcoming challenges, making his statement particularly resonant with fans who appreciate his honest portrayal of life's difficulties.
